爱资料 网 欢迎您的到来,我们在这里提供了免费网页模板、编程资料、开发资料、开发软件、在线工具
thinkphp 3.2 where 字符串条件处理_编程资料分享

thinkphp 3.2 where 字符串条件处理_编程资料分享

浏览次数:123 更新时间:2018-04-15 23:00:09

使用字符串条件的时候,建议配合预处理机制,确保更加安全,例如: $Model-where(id=%d and username=%s and xx=%f,array($id,$username,$xx))-select(); 如果$id变量来自用户提交或者URL地址的话,如果传入...

thinkphp IIS伪静态排除静态文件目录或其他目录

thinkphp IIS伪静态排除静态文件目录或其他目录

浏览次数:133 更新时间:2018-04-13 14:24:49

在使用IIS的时候thinkphp做伪静态重写会遇到把目录也当成控制器来运行,这个时候我们就需要排除这些目录。 IIS下规则添加 创建新的空白规则: ^(?!Public)(.*).html$ 重写到 /index.php?s={R:1...

thinkphp 重写警告提示

thinkphp 重写警告提示

浏览次数:156 更新时间:2017-10-04 12:37:26

那是因为重写的error和父类的error参数名不一致导致的警告提示。 php方法重写要求是要参数个数、方法名称与父类要一致的...

Thinkphp中删除缓存目录

Thinkphp中删除缓存目录

浏览次数:98 更新时间:2016-08-03 02:55:51

publicfunctioncache_clear(){$this-deldir(TEMP_PATH);}functiondeldir($dir){$dh=opendir($dir);while($file=readdir($dh)){if($file!=.$file!=..){$fullpath=$dir./.$file;if(!is_dir($fullpath)){unlink($fullpath);}else{deldir($fullpath);}}}} 使用方...

ThinkPHP让../Public在模板不解析(直接输出)的方法

ThinkPHP让../Public在模板不解析(直接输出)的方法

浏览次数:189 更新时间:2015-10-22 11:26:13

本文实例讲述了ThinkPHP让../Public在模板不解析的方法。分享给大家供大家参考。具体如下: 问题: 模板中包含../Public需要直接输出,但是../Public会被直接替换为当前公共模板目录,最终...

thinkPHP 无法加载某某控制器的原因

thinkPHP 无法加载某某控制器的原因

浏览次数:244 更新时间:2015-10-14 00:19:39

如下图无法加载所编写的控制器: 这个时候就要考虑自己的控制器是否路径不对或者编写的格式不对。 一般控制器是xxxController.class.php 看看是否 是自己的格式不对导致的错误。...